### 4.2.0 — Renamed `ROTOR_KEY_NAME` to `VAULTSPIN_ROTATION_CREDENTIAL`

The Vaultspin rotation utility previously reused a variable name inherited from the deprecated Rotorhand scripts, which caused confusion during quarterly audits at the Brindlemark office. The new name matches the naming convention enforced by the config linter in 4.x. No behavioral change; the rotation schedule and grace window are unaffected. After upgrading, replace the old variable in each deployment's environment file with the following line:

secret setting of bajeg-yahog: LEDGER_TOKEN20=f833f3e2e6625ec0dee3

Finance Review — Loyalty Overhaul. The Amberpoint Rewards revamp cost 2.1m against a 1.8m budget. Redemption rates rose 14%; breakage fell faster than modelled, compressing margin by 40bps. Q3 enrolment in the Velden region exceeded forecast. Write-down of legacy points liability completed. Recommendation: approve phase two funding at reduced scope. The strategic rationale ahead of the board vote follows below.

confidential, kagep-kahof: Druokax Systems plans to lower the Ulaath list price by 53 percent in March.

# Service Accounts — Resolver Batching

Quick context for reviewers: the old Thistledown GraphQL resolvers fired one query per author per post — classic N+1. The fix batches everything through the new Loaderbin service, so expect the dataloader wiring in `resolvers/feed.js` to look chunky. It's fine, promise. The batching layer runs under the svc-loaderbin account, which calls the Marrowgate cache internally. For local testing, svc-loaderbin authenticates with the key below.

gateway credential: vxb23-HxQ21C0wnch2XjJUYrBndSF